The four remaining contenders face two more culinary challenges as they battle for a place in the semi-finals. First they are split into two groups for a test of teamwork and communication. One duo has to master John Torode's dim sum selection, and the other his spiced duck noodle broth. Then, the celebrities' team work skills are pushed to the extreme as they are faced with their first Mass Catering Challenge, cooking lunch for over 100 staff at Acton Works - the central hub for repairs and upgrades to London Underground trains.

The battle for the first two semi-final places in this year's competition reaches its climax, as the four remaining celebrities are tasked with cooking a faultless two-course meal that will not only be judged by John Torode and Gregg Wallace, but also by three previous contenders - Olympic long-jumper Greg Rutherford, and TV personalities Vicky Pattison and Dom Parker. All three know what it takes to get through this competition and are in for a treat as their successors pull out all the stops to try secure their semi-final place. For those who don't cut the mustard, the journey ends here.
